Aga Khan Palace
The Aga Khan Palace is a majestic historical monument in Pune, Maharashtra, known for its architectural grandeur and its significant role in India's freedom struggle. It houses the memorials of Mahatma Gandhi, his wife Kasturba Gandhi, and his secretary Mahadev Desai, who were interned here during the Quit India Movement.
